The weights (in pounds) of 6 vehicles and the variability of their braking distances (in feet) when stopping on a dry surface are shown in the table. Can you conclude that there is a significant linear correlation between vehicle weight and variability in braking distance on a dry surface? Use a = 0.05. Weight, X 5920 5330 6500 5100 5880 4800 Variability in 1.96 1.59 1.62 braking distance, y 1.78 1.94 1.50 ck here to view a table of critical values for Student's t-distribution.
